From IIT to acting and now a serious relationship confession, Amol Parashar’s love life just got a lot more interesting. The actor, known for his roles in Sardar Udham and other projects, has long kept his personal life under wraps. But recent sightings alongside the talented Konkona Sen Sharma have stirred up buzz, suggesting the duo might be ready to step into the spotlight together. As fans eagerly watch, Amol opens up about his relationship and why he’s been hesitant to share it publicly—until now.
Amol Parashar and Konkona Sen Sharma’s rumoured romance has been quietly simmering, sparking curiosity across the entertainment world. Konkona, a revered actress-turned-filmmaker known for her nuanced performances, and Amol recently made their first joint appearance at the special screening of Amol’s new web series, Gram Chikitsalay, held at Excel Entertainment in Khar. The event quickly became a highlight for fans as Konkona impressed in a sleek grey power suit, exuding confidence, while Amol looked sharp in a blue striped suit. Their warm interaction and shared smiles left little doubt about their closeness.
Despite the growing speculation, both stars had remained tight-lipped about their relationship. However, in an interview with TOI, Amol opened up about why he’s kept his love life private. He emphasised that nothing stops him from sharing, but he values the “sanctity” and “purity” of a real relationship, preferring to express his emotions through his work rather than public declarations. Amol said he wants people to focus on his craft, with his personal feelings and vulnerabilities coming to life in his roles, not the headlines.
Amol also revealed that he and his partner aren’t hiding their relationship. They attend social events and mingle openly, but don’t feel the need to broadcast it. “This is my longest relationship so far,” he shared, reflecting on how they’ve weathered challenges together, including the lockdown. With their bond growing stronger and more serious, it seems only a matter of time before Amol and Konkona officially confirm their romance. Until then, fans can only enjoy their subtle but undeniable chemistry whenever they appear together.
